the rear mount should have been put on the crossmember when the motor was out. You should not have a problem with those ebay mounts I have seen quite a few cars with them. If you are talking about the rear L bracket for the tranny good luck getting it in with the motor in it should have been put in while the motor was going in. You might have to jack up the engine and unbolt the mounts to get it to go in.
the rear mount is allways the worst to put in no mater what mounts you use... i have the first set (series) of place racing mounts ever made and had a problem puting the rear mount in back 1997 and still it is the hardest mount to put in .. take your time ... have a friend use a jack from the front of the car to move the motor around whyle you move the mount into place..IMO it is easyer to drop the motor in from the top but if you have the moter close to bolting up it might be easyer to remove the crossmember to make room .....good luck..
I helped a friend a while back and he was having trouble with the rear mount also.
Ended up being that the rear mount has 2 places it can be bolted in might check that.
